Hoarding Hints

HordingAdvertising through hoardings is big business. Owners of buildings, including societies, try to augment their resources by successfully exploiting this source of revenue. Hoardings are put up on the terrace or in the compound or on the walls of a building. We also find roadside hoardings which generally belong to advertising agencies. As these hoardings are big enough, and leveled quite high, they are easily spotted. Their bright colours and larger than life figures catch everyone's eyes. This is the reason why hoardings are so much in demand.

Companies prefer to display their products and information on hoardings as a lot of people tend to view hoardings en route to their workplace or while going home. Hoardings reach out to a vast section of society. Points to remember while booking a hoarding for advertisement:


location  does matter!Area: You should decide on which area you wish to advertise in. The location of your hoarding will depend on the type and class of client you wish to reach out to.

Rates: This again depends on the area and exposure.

Time: Heavy discounts are available if you book a hoarding for a long period of time. Charges per month are cheaper if you book the hoarding for a longer duration.

Focus: If you wish to have a bright light that focuses on your hoarding at night, this could cost you more.

Hoardings at different places belong to different agencies, and have to be booked on a rent basis. Generally it's very difficult to find an empty hoarding in Bangalore
